In this role you will:

  • Process orders submitted by Account Executives according to the standards and practices outlined in the Sales Order Process document in accordance with Branch Order Coordinator best practices including but not limited to:
    1. Determine order type (Equipment IT Hardware IT Services Software Consulting or Maintenance Agreement)
    2. Verify that the AE has submitted all of the necessary paperwork
    3. Obtain credit approval based on established guidelines
    4. Verify the accuracy and pricing of each line item on the sales order
    5. Process any revisions to sales orders by adding or removing items changing pricing revising bill-to and ship-to information
  • Project Manage the delivery installation and training process in accordance with DIT Coordinator best practices. This would include but not limited to:
    1. Serve as the customers point of contact through the completion of delivery installation and training
    2. Lead in the effort to obtain the required logistical delivery installation and required network and connectivity information as well as identifying training needs of the customer
  • Demonstrate proficiency in the following task areas within eAutomate:
    1. Sales order processing
    2. Inventory management
    3. Service call input & dispatch
    4. Equipment record updating & management
    5. Customer record creation & management
  • Daily updating of sales orders to ensure the accuracy of the Sales Order Log
  • Work closely with Account Executives and various other departments as required
  • Assist service department as needed for loaner equipment and parts procurement
  • Coordinate equipment moves and pickups with external customers
  • Receive shipments from vendors/suppliers into system
  • Manage inventory at the branch including but not limited to: supplies demo equipment stock used and wholesale equipment
  • Warehouse duties include but are not limited to:
    1. Monthly inventory of all warehouse items
    2. Manage the used equipment wholesale process
    3. Managing toner recycle program
    4. Resolving freight and vendor damage claims
  • Miscellaneous job duties as assigned

You should have: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Excellent organizational skills
  • Ability to handle multiple tasks both effectively and efficiently
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office applications including Word Excel and Outlook
  • The ability to quickly learn internal software for managing sales orders delivery logistics and inventory control
  • Available to work overtime with little or no advance notice
  • May push or lift equipment weighing 50 lbs. on wheels
